## Deployment

The N+1 fix in Quillgraph batches resolver lookups through a per-request dataloader. No schema changes. Roll out to canary first; watch query latency on the Bramblehook dashboard for 15 minutes before full rollout. Rollback is a single redeploy of the previous image. If customers report stale nested fields, clear the loader cache and retry. The relevant configuration values are as follows.

service settings:
[casax]
port = 6379
team = rusir
host = casax.zemvarhq.corp
region = outer-4
access_code = ac_9808ce
timeout_ms = 1500

Heads up, support folks — this PR reworks the thumbnail generation queue in Picturo. Uploads should stop getting stuck in "processing" forever: failed jobs now retry automatically and anything truly broken lands in a visible dead-letter view you can check before escalating. Big images are resized in stages, so timeouts drop too. The retry and sizing constants are below.

constants for fajop-tahaf:
RATE_LIMITS = {
    "holael": 2,
    "oliael": 10,
    "druael": 10,
    "wenwyn": 10,
}

# FareForge Onboarding

FareForge evaluates shipping-fee rules in priority order; ties are broken by rule creation date. Rule bundles are compiled nightly and pushed to the edge cache by the deploy pipeline. Pushes are rejected unless the bundle is signed, so keep the key current when rotating. The signing key used by the pipeline is the following.

release key, yafog-kadug: bky13_ADqM5YQWZutLX

- [ ] **Step 7 — Fareline pricing-experiment key recovery.** Before rotating the signing key for the Fareline ticket-pricing experiment, confirm both witnesses have verified the ceremony log and the hardware token is sealed. If the token fails to initialise, fall back to manual recovery using the passphrase recorded immediately below this item.

recovery phrase for tagug-yagug: lamox-gilax-keleth-gilath

CI note for review: the nightly archive job for Coldvault buckets was timing out because the manifest scan walked every object twice. Switched to a single-pass scan with a cursor checkpoint; runtime dropped from 3h to 40m. Retention rules unchanged. Please confirm the checkpoint file is excluded from the archive itself. The passing run is identified by the token below.

trace token, fafog-kageg: htk4_98e6